This heavy foreshadowing creates a sense that Beowulfs death, although tragic for his people, is not only inevitable but unremarkable: all kings die, even the best, and even the most powerful tribes are doomed to slavery and abasement (l.3155). For the Beowulf poet, however, the pull of fate is so strong that an event that is fated to happen in the future already has a strong presence. When a king dies, his people become vulnerable to the marauding forces beyond their borders. The poem clearly announces that Beowulf will defeat Grendel: [Grendels] fate that night / was due to change, his days of ravening / had come to an end (ll.733-5).
